AN ACT
To authorize the Administrator of the United States Agency for
International Development to prescribe the manner in which programs of
the agency are identified overseas, and for other purposes.
Be it enacted by the Senate and House of Representatives of the
United States of America in Congress assembled,

SECTION 1. SHORT TITLE.
This Act may be cited as the ``USAID Branding Modernization Act''.
SEC. 2. AUTHORIZATION FOR BRANDING.
(a) In General.--The Administrator of the United States Agency for
International Development (referred to in this section as ``USAID''),
in coordination with the Secretary of State, as appropriate, and with
due consideration for the safety and security of implementing partners
and beneficiaries, is authorized to prescribe, as appropriate, the use
of logos or other insignia of the USAID Identity, or the use of
additional or substitute markings, including the United States flag, to
appropriately identify, including as required by section 641 of the
Foreign Assistance Act of 1961 (22 U.S.C. 2401), overseas programs
administered by USAID.
(b) Audit.--Not later than 1 year after the date of the enactment
of this Act, the Inspector General of USAID shall submit to Congress an
audit of compliance with relevant branding and marking requirements of
USAID by implementing partners funded by USAID, including any
requirements prescribed pursuant to the authorization under subsection
(a).
